├── .github └── FUNDING.yml ├── .gitignore ├── LICENSE ├── README.md ├── project ├── build.properties └── plugins.sbt └── src └── main └── scala └── com └── example └── akka ├── DefaultJsonFormats.scala ├── Rest.scala ├── add ├── AddActor.scala └── AddService.scala ├── addoption ├── AddOptionActor.scala └── AddOptionService.scala ├── echoenum ├── EchoEnumService.scala └── SizeEnum.scala ├── echoenumeratum ├── EchoEnumeratumService.scala └── SizeEnum.scala ├── echolist └── EchoListService.scala ├── hello ├── HelloActor.scala └── HelloService.scala └── swagger ├── SwaggerDocService.scala └── SwaggerHttpWithUiService.scala /.github/FUNDING.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/.github/FUNDING.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/README.md -------------------------------------------------------------------------------- /project/build.properties: -------------------------------------------------------------------------------- 1 | sbt.version=1.9.0 2 | 3 | -------------------------------------------------------------------------------- /project/plugins.sbt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/project/plugins.sbt -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/DefaultJsonFormats.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/DefaultJsonFormats.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/Rest.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/Rest.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/add/AddActor.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/add/AddActor.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/add/AddService.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/add/AddService.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/addoption/AddOptionActor.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/addoption/AddOptionActor.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/addoption/AddOptionService.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/addoption/AddOptionService.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/echoenum/EchoEnumService.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/echoenum/EchoEnumService.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/echoenum/SizeEnum.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/echoenum/SizeEnum.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/echoenumeratum/EchoEnumeratumService.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/echoenumeratum/EchoEnumeratumService.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/echoenumeratum/SizeEnum.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/echoenumeratum/SizeEnum.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/echolist/EchoListService.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/echolist/EchoListService.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/hello/HelloActor.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/hello/HelloActor.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/hello/HelloService.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/hello/HelloService.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/swagger/SwaggerDocService.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/swagger/SwaggerDocService.scala -------------------------------------------------------------------------------- /src/main/scala/com/example/akka/swagger/SwaggerHttpWithUiService.scala: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pjfanning/swagger-akka-http-sample/HEAD/src/main/scala/com/example/akka/swagger/SwaggerHttpWithUiService.scala --------------------------------------------------------------------------------